  • Colorado Oil and Fuel Conservation Fee (COGCC)

    The COGCC serves as the first regulatory physique overseeing hydrocarbon exploration, manufacturing, and transportation inside Colorado. The fee develops and enforces guidelines associated to properly allowing, drilling practices, waste administration, and environmental safety. As an illustration, the COGCC’s guidelines on wellbore integrity purpose to forestall leaks and spills that would contaminate groundwater. These laws considerably influence operational procedures and funding selections throughout the trade, making certain accountable growth of assets whereas minimizing environmental dangers. The COGCC’s regulatory authority offers a framework for accountable useful resource administration and environmental safety.

  • Air High quality Management

    Rules aimed toward controlling air emissions from hydrocarbon operations deal with considerations about air air pollution and greenhouse fuel emissions. These laws set up limits on risky natural compounds (VOCs) and methane emissions, requiring firms to implement management applied sciences and monitoring techniques. The Air Air pollution Management Division of the Colorado Division of Public Well being and Atmosphere performs a key position in implementing these laws. For instance, laws mandate using vapor restoration models to seize VOCs throughout storage and loading operations, decreasing air air pollution and defending public well being. These laws drive technological innovation and promote the adoption of cleaner operational practices throughout the trade.

  • Horizontal Drilling and Hydraulic Fracturing

    Horizontal drilling, coupled with hydraulic fracturing (fracking), has revolutionized hydrocarbon extraction in Colorado, significantly in shale formations just like the Niobrara and Codell. This expertise allows entry to beforehand uneconomical reserves by drilling horizontally by way of the formation after which injecting high-pressure fluid to fracture the rock and launch trapped hydrocarbons. Whereas considerably growing manufacturing, this expertise additionally raises environmental considerations associated to water utilization, chemical components, and induced seismicity, necessitating ongoing analysis and growth to attenuate potential impacts. The widespread adoption of this expertise has reshaped the panorama of hydrocarbon manufacturing, impacting each financial output and environmental issues.

  • Superior Imaging and Information Analytics

    Refined imaging applied sciences, resembling 3D seismic surveys and microseismic monitoring, present detailed subsurface info, enabling firms to pinpoint hydrocarbon reservoirs with larger accuracy. Mixed with superior information analytics, these applied sciences optimize properly placement, scale back exploration prices, and enhance manufacturing effectivity. For instance, real-time information evaluation throughout drilling operations permits for changes to drilling parameters, minimizing dangers and maximizing useful resource restoration. These developments improve operational effectivity and contribute to extra knowledgeable decision-making all through the exploration and manufacturing lifecycle.

  • Automation and Distant Operations

    Automation and distant operations applied sciences are more and more being deployed in Colorado’s hydrocarbon fields. These applied sciences enhance security by decreasing the necessity for personnel in hazardous environments and improve operational effectivity by enabling steady monitoring and optimization of manufacturing processes. For instance, automated properly management techniques can detect and reply to stress adjustments, stopping blowouts and minimizing environmental dangers. Distant operations facilities enable engineers to watch and management a number of properly websites from a central location, enhancing operational effectivity and decreasing response instances to potential points. These applied sciences improve each security and productiveness throughout the trade.

  • Leak Detection and Environmental Monitoring

    Superior leak detection and environmental monitoring applied sciences play a significant position in mitigating environmental impacts. Refined sensors and monitoring techniques detect and pinpoint leaks in pipelines and wellbores, enabling speedy response and minimizing environmental harm. Actual-time monitoring of air and water high quality offers crucial information for assessing environmental impacts and making certain compliance with regulatory necessities. For instance, aerial surveys utilizing infrared cameras can detect methane leaks from pipelines, enabling immediate repairs and decreasing greenhouse fuel emissions.
